mlx5_core: Add support for page faults events and low level handling
* Add a handler function pointer in the mlx5_core_qp struct for page fault events. Handle page fault events by calling the handler function, if not NULL. * Add on-demand paging capability query command. * Export command for resuming QPs after page faults. * Add various constants related to paging support.
